As a Sr. Account Executive – Trail Run, you will drive sales growth, market penetration, and brand presence in the rapidly evolving trail running category. You’ll manage and grow key accounts, prospect new opportunities, and deliver strategic, data-driven recommendations to strengthen Merrell’s position as a leading trail run brand.

Primary Duties:

  • Drive growth in the trail run channel: Expand distribution with high-potential specialty and strategic accounts, identifying opportunities to capture market share and increase sell-through.

  • Lead account strategy: Develop and execute business plans for key accounts, aligning product assortments, forecasts, and marketing activations to maximize revenue and profitability.

  • Be the voice of the trail run consumer: Partner with Merchandising, Marketing, and Product teams to ensure assortments meet the needs of trail runners across performance, versatility, and innovation.

  • Deliver compelling presentations: Sell-in seasonal assortments, leading with key SKUs and stories, and present data-driven recommendations for maximizing margin and sell-through.

  • Own the ground game: Maintain consistent in-store visitation to ensure brand presence, merchandising execution, and staff engagement. Support events, demos, and activations that build community and drive trial.

  • Analyze and optimize: Monitor model stocks, sell-through rates, and inventory levels, recommending markdowns or reorders as needed to optimize business health.

  • Build the future pipeline: Maintain a robust prospect list, identifying and converting new trail run accounts in underserved markets.

  • Report and communicate: Provide weekly sales recaps, account health insights, and market feedback to leadership to inform future strategies.

  • Performing duties consistent with the Company’s AAP/EEO goals and policies.

  • Performing other duties as required/assigned by manager.

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ities Required:

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ent work experience.

  • 5+ years in wholesale or specialty retail sales (outdoor, run specialty, or sporting goods experience preferred).

  • Strong relationship builder with proven ability to open and grow accounts.

  • Trail running marketplace knowledge (competitors, trends, consumer insights) and passion for the category.

  • Excellent sales presentation and strategic selling skills, with the ability to influence at all levels.

  • Proficient in MS Office (Excel, PowerPoint, Word) and experienced in leveraging data for sales strategies.

  • Working knowledge of retail math (gross margin, turn, markdowns).

  • Self-starter with strong organizational skills and 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.

Working Conditions:

Field sales environment. Extensive travel required (70%).  Ability to push, pull and lift up to 50 lbs.

Founded in 1883 on the belief in the possibility of opportunity, Wolverine World Wide, Inc. (NYSE: WWW) is one of the world’s leading marketers and licensors of branded casual, active lifestyle, work, outdoor sport, athletic, children's and uniform footwear and apparel. Through a diverse portfolio of highly recognized brands, our products are designed to empower, engage and inspire our consumers every step of the way. The company’s portfolio includes Merrell®, Sperry®, Hush Puppies®, Saucony®, Wolverine®, Keds®, Stride Rite®, Chaco®, Bates®, and HYTEST®. Wolverine Worldwide is also the global footwear licensee of the popular brands Cat® and Harley-Davidson®. Based in Rockford, Michigan, for more than 130 years, our products are carried by leading retailers in the U.S. and globally in approximately 170 countries and territories.
